Biographical details, hobbies & interests |
Originally from Kent, I have lived in Leeds since 1989. I have previously worked as an army medic, an analyst programmer, a secondary teacher, and a staff nurse on a medium secure PICU ward. I currently work as a charge nurse (band 6) on a female acute ward. My interests are: flamenco guitar; olympic weightlifting; crime novels; and going to metal gigs, the cinema, skiing and hillwalking with my son. |
